#BBFFD6 Hex color

#BBFFD6

The hexadecimal color code #BBFFD6 corresponds to the code RGB( 187, 255, 214 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,73 level), green (at 1,00 level) and blue (at 0,84 level). Its brightness is 86% and its saturation is 100%. It is composed of red at 28%, green at 38% and blue at 32%.
